Soil Compaction Essentials: Choosing the Right machine

When it comes to soil compaction, selecting the appropriate instrument is paramount for achieving optimal results. The type of compactor you choose will rely on factors such as the size of your project, the character of the soil, and the desired compaction level.

  • For smaller areas, a walk-behind compactor might be suitable. These units are mobile and simple to maneuver.
  • Larger projects will likely demand a powered compactor. These machines offer greater strength and can cover space more quickly.
  • Consider the kind of soil you're working with. Sandy soils compact easily, while clay soils may demand a robust compactor.

Ultimately, the best way to choose the ideal soil compaction tool is to consult with a qualified expert. They can evaluate your requirements and suggest the most appropriate solution.

Comprehending Plate Compactors and Their Applications

Plate compactors are essential tools in the construction industry. These robust machines compact soil layers, creating a stable foundation for various projects. Plate compactors employ a vibrating plate that transmits force to the ground, effectively consolidating the material.

Their applications extend a wide range of tasks, including:

* Preparing construction sites for laying foundations.

* Compacting gravel and soil for roads and driveways.

* Strengthening embankments and slopes.

Additionally, plate compactors are valuable in landscaping projects, such as smoothing ground surfaces for lawns and gardens. The adaptability of plate compactors makes them an indispensable asset for both large-scale construction and smaller-scale groundworks.
